Etymology[edit]

Borrowing from dialectal German Fleischschnecke, from Fleisch (meat) + Schnecke (snail, pastry in the form of a snail).

Noun[edit]

Des Fleischnacka accompagnés d'une salade verte

fleischschnacka f (plural fleischschnacka) (usually plural)

  1. an Alsatian meat-stuffed noodle dish, typically made with minced beef
